Who you are

The Senior WordPress Developer is a front end developer who successfully delivers digital projects and website maintenance work in concert with the Hydrant team. This person should be an ambitious learner, willing to pick up the latest trends in technologies we use and contribute to our general knowledgebank. They’ll work with other developers to execute maintenance and coding for a variety of projects touching multiple clients. They should be geared for a fast paced environment and ready to pivot often.

  • You’ve got 3+ years of experience working with WordPress websites and other front end technologies
  • Experience with WordPress, including custom theme and block development and an overall understanding of the WordPress core
  • Proficiency with front end development, including SCSS
  • Proficiency and dedication to organized project file structures and syntactic style compliance
  • As a plus, you’ve got experience with: Shopify, Vue.js, and/or development ops (SFTP, command line server work)
  • You are a self starter – this position will lead our WordPress Development
  • You’re an adaptive contributor
  • You are a collaborative project planner
  • You don’t believe in resting on your laurels and easily tackle situations of ambiguity to figure out how to keep yourself and your work moving forward
  • You work with your project team to understand, act, and deliver on next steps translated from product and client needs
  • You’re eager to jump in on tasks to support your team as needed
  • You want to constantly improve client service, business, and development practices in yourself and your team

What you’ll do

  • Take on various development-related tasks, to support different processes and needs on assigned projects
  • Objectively explain and represent your contributions and deliverables to your team and clients
  • Clearly communicate with your project team to make sure they have full context of your work and that you have the same of theirs, jumping in on other tasks as needed
  • Collaborate directly every day with designers, developers, strategists, and clients
